It is a strong acid with a pH of around 1 and can dissolve many … Nitric acid is the inorganic compound with the formula HNO3. It is a highly corrosive mineral acid. The compound is colorless, but older samples tend to be yellow cast due to decomposition into oxides of nitrogen. Most commercially available nitric acid has a concentration of 68% in water. When the solution contains more than 86% HNO3, it is referred to as fuming nitric acid. Dependi…

WebbFormal Charge Calculation of Nitric Acid Formal charge of each of the atom in a whole molecular species can be calculated using the following formula- Formal charge = Total number of valance electrons – number of electrons remain as nonbonded – (number of electrons involved in bond formation/2) WebbThe molecule of nitric acid is neutral. However, it has nitrogen with a formal charge of +1 and oxygen with a formal charge of -1 in its structure.
